Pyunkang Yul Essence Toner Review

I have been working through a lot of toners and after a month of continued use, here are my thoughts on the Pyunkang Yul Essence Toner.

The Pyunkang Yul packaging is all very minimal and has a medical look, this toner sports a blue packing with an easy pop-off top. You get 200ml of product which should last you about 3 months with continued use day and night. This retails for approx £10-£11 depending on your membership on YesStyle and what offers are on.


Formulated with 90% Astragalus Membrenaceus Root Extract instead of water, this toner helps repair skin damage and revitalise skin. It is suitable for all skin types including sensitive and acne-prone. There are a few ways to use this toner; applying directly on the skin, using a cotton pad and can also be used as a mask by soaking a cotton pad and layering on your skin for a longer amount of time.


The consistency when it comes out the bottle is thicker than water but once you apply it onto your skin it becomes watery and you have time to 'pat' this into your skin. Many people use this toner to layer aka the 7 skin method, where you layer the product on your skin 7 times for full impact. There is completely no scent to this and the toner sinks in nicely and does not leave you skin sticky after. It truly hydrates and works.


In terms of toner, I prefer something that has a little more impact like the Hada Labo Premium Toner which plumps my skin in the first use, this toner also reminds me of The Body Shop Hydrating Toner but without the scent if you are looking for a brand that is more accessible. Overall I like this toner, it does what it needs to do and has not caused me any irritation even when I layer this product for more hydration.
